Each restaurant has its own special recipe for Spanish bull tail stew, some using red wine, others opting for Andalusian sherry, or even a bit of brandy. Rabo de toro is traditionally served with homemade french fries at most casual restaurants. By the 19th century, the Spanish oxtail stew became a staple recipe in Andalusian houses, in part thanks to the rise of the bullfighting world and those who represented it. But once it cooks long enough, it becomes so tender that it nearly dissolves in your mouth (similar to my Spanish beef stewrecipe). Cook them until they get a nice golden colour.
